A leading healthcare recruitment agency is seeking enthusiastic Occupational Therapists to work in Hertfordshire and West Essex. Multiple roles are available across various services including paediatrics, mental health, and stroke rehabilitation.
The positions offer competitive NHS salaries and an extensive relocation package that includes costs for visas, flights, and accommodation. The role provides excellent opportunities for career development along with a supportive induction program. Enjoy a balanced lifestyle with both countryside and city life.
